Veidekke Entreprenad AB
Veidekke in Sweden is part of Veidekke ASA, which is Scandinavia's fourth largest construction and civil engineering company with approximately 8,000 employees. The group has a turnover of about 43 billion NOK. The operations in Sweden employ around 2,200 people and have a turnover of approximately 15.1 billion NOK, focusing on construction and civil engineering projects.
Veidekke began with road surfacing, known as "veidekking" in Norwegian, in Norway back in 1936 and has since built communities and infrastructure in Norway, Sweden, and Denmark. Veidekke is list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ange and has never reported a loss.

**About the Position**
As an Estimator, you will be involved from the start of the bidding process to the completion of the bid proposal and handover to the project team. Your tasks will vary throughout the year and with the projects. You will be part of our estimating team, where we support each other in planning and coordinating work alongside other roles and functions in the region. Together, we utilize our knowledge to find the best solutions. You will also participate in project kick-offs, which involves close collaboration with procurement, site management, and production staff. Building new customer relationships is part of the daily routine.
**We are looking for someone who has:**
- An engineering degree/construction technical education or equivalent experience.
- At least 2 years of experience in a similar role with knowledge and experience in concrete and/or earthworks and other types of civil engineering projects.
- A good understanding of construction technology.
- A valid driver's license (B).
- Experience with MAP, Bidcon, or similar estimating software.
- Knowledge of construction law.
